Research’s significance in today’s business schools has been highlighted in recent years. Keeping up with the newest business trends, technology, growth, and theories is essential in today’s ever-changing corporate environment. This article will discuss the importance of business school research and how it might benefit prospective and current MBA students.

Secondly, if you want to know what’s happening in the business world right now, you need to do some investigating. When it comes to research, business schools are at the forefront, with a plethora of resources covering everything from marketing to finance. MBA students who are interested in enhancing their competence in these areas may find this material to be very helpful. MBA students can increase their chances of getting hired and advancing in their careers by keeping up with the most recent academic findings.

Second, research fosters originality and imagination. New ideas and theories are constantly being investigated in business schools, tested in the real world, and honed over time. MBA students can gain from this process by being exposed to cutting-edge technologies and methodologies and learning novel ways of approaching problems. MBA students who actively participate in research have a greater chance of developing the innovative and creative mindsets necessary for professional success.

Finally, research can aid MBA students in expanding their professional networks. MBA students benefit from the close relationships between business schools and experts and leaders in their fields because of the opportunities this creates for networking. MBA students benefit from networking with professionals in their field by participating in educational events such as seminars, conferences, and workshops.

Finally, research can aid in the cultivation of critical thinking skills among MBA students. MBA students learn to think critically and analytically as they interact with cutting-edge research. They are taught to question the information they are given and determine whether or not it is useful to them. MBA students who take the time to hone their critical thinking abilities will be better equipped to solve problems and make sound decisions once they enter the workforce.

In conclusion, research is an integral element of the MBA program, giving students access to a variety of knowledge, experience, and possibilities. MBA hopefuls and students who actively participate in academic research at business schools are better able to keep up with the latest developments in the field, cultivate an innovative and creative mindset, expand their professional network, and sharpen their analytical and critical thinking skills. These advantages may pave the way for MBA students to realize their potential as future company leaders.
